2. Locust Bean Gum
Locust bean gum is a natural thickening agent and stabilizer extracted from the seeds of the carob tree. It is commonly utilized in the food industry to enhance texture and consistency in different products, consisting of ice creams, sauces, and salad dressings. 4. Hydrolysed Guar Gum and Depolymerized Guar
Hydrolysed guar gum and depolymerized guar are two plant-based ingredients that discover applications in the food industry as stabilizers, thickeners, and emulsifiers. These ingredients are especially useful in developing low-calorie and reduced-fat food products. They assist enhance the texture and mouthfeel of products while likewise enhancing their shelf stability. Products like soups, sauces, and salad dressings can gain from these natural options to traditional ingredients.

6. Hydrolysed Vegetable Protein
Hydrolysed vegetable protein is a flexible ingredient that can add umami and tasty flavors to plant-based food products. It is frequently utilized as a flavor enhancer in vegan and vegetarian dishes, helping to imitate the taste of meat and dairy items.
